Night closure of Mehrauli-Gurgaon road for Metro work

A 10 km stretch on the Mehrauli-Gurgaon road will be closed from midnight to 6 a.m. from Saturday till July 9 for Metro construction work, officials said.

"To facilitate construction of the Gurgaon extension of the Delhi Metro, the Mehrauli-Gurgaon (MG) Road will remain blocked on both sides from Manglapuri (Mandi Cut) to Ayanagar Mod from 12 midnight to 6 a.m. from Saturday till July 9," a Delhi Metro Rail Corporation (DMRC) statement said.

This is the first time that a stretch so long is being completely blocked for construction. Previously DMRC has constructed interim detours or rerouted traffic nearby, an official said.

Vehicles will have to use National Highway 8 or the Gurgaon-Faridabad Road and the Gaddipur-Mandi Road instead, the statement added.

Traffic movement on the stretch will remain normal during day time.
